Fomento Economico Mexicano (NYSE:FMX) Upgraded to Buy at Bank of America

Fomento Economico Mexicano (NYSE:FMXGet Free Report) was upgraded by investment analysts at Bank of America from a “neutral” rating to a “buy” rating in a note issued to investors on Tuesday, Marketbeat reports. The brokerage currently has a $150.00 price target on the stock. Bank of America‘s price objective indicates a potential upside of 19.35% from the stock’s previous close.

A number of other research firms have also commented on FMX. UBS Group lifted their target price on Fomento Economico Mexicano from $122.00 to $139.00 and gave the stock a “buy” rating in a report on Thursday, May 28th. Weiss Ratings raised Fomento Economico Mexicano from a “hold (c-)” rating to a “hold (c)” rating in a report on Monday, May 11th. Wall Street Zen cut Fomento Economico Mexicano from a “bu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a research report on Saturday, July 18th. Zacks Research upgraded Fomento Economico Mexicano from a “hold” rating to a “strong-buy” rating in a report on Thursday, April 30th.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. upped their target price on shares of Fomento Economico Mexicano from $117.00 to $126.00 and gave the company an “overweight” rating in a research note on Friday, June 26th. One investment analyst has r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, five have given a Buy rating and three have given a Hold rating to the company’s stock. According to MarketBeat, the stock currently has a consensus rating of “Moderate Buy” and a consensus price target of $123.86.

Fomento Económico Mexicano, SAB. de C.V. (FEMSA) is a Mexican multinational company active primarily in the retail and beverage sectors. Headquartered in Monterrey, Mexico, FEMSA’s operations span convenience store retailing, beverage bottling and distribution, and related logistics and consumer services. The company’s business model combines high-frequency retail outlets with large-scale beverage production and a regional supply chain network.

FEMSA Comercio, the company’s retail arm, operates a large chain of convenience stores under the OXXO brand and has expanded its retail footprint with complementary formats and services.
